Released , 'Closing Gambit: 1978 Korchnoi versus Karpov and the Kremlin' stars Anatoli Karpov, Viktor Korchnoi, Garry Kasparov, Viswanathan Anand The mov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 25 min, and received a user score of 87 (out of 100) on TMDb, which collated reviews from 3 well-known users.

You probably already know what the movie's about, but just in case... Here's the plot: "The story of the 1978 World Chess Championship between the Soviet Communist Party's protege, Anatoly Karpov and the traitor and Soviet defector, Viktor Korchnoi. One of those instances in life where truth is stranger than fiction."
